Former Employee – worked at Wynn Resorts
Pros – Beautiful surroundings with an International brand recognition.
Cons – Lowest pay on the Strip
High degree of turn-around
No one knows whats going on
Great disconnect between management and their employees
Horrible vacation - one week per year, and you can't take it until you've been there one year.
Most people are there to get some experience and move on
Advice to Senior Management – Giving people better pay and a better time off policy would be a good start. Mandating that all departments participate in the recognition programs would be nice too - they pump you up in orientation to believe that you'll be recognized for your hard work - not all departments do it or care.
